What Are the Key Symbols for Taylor Swift?

Throughout her career, Taylor Swift has employed a variety of symbols that resonate with her life experiences and artistic expression. Some of the most significant symbols for Taylor Swift include:

  • The Snake: Often seen as a representation of betrayal and transformation, the snake became a powerful symbol during her "Reputation" era.
  • The Heart: A universal symbol of love and heartbreak, hearts frequently appear in her lyrics and visuals.
  • The Cat: Swift's beloved cats, Olivia Benson and Meredith Grey, symbolize comfort and companionship in her life.
  • The Color Red: Associated with passion and intensity, red symbolizes the emotional highs and lows captured in her music.

What Do the Symbols Represent in Her Music?

In her music, symbols serve as narrative devices that enhance the lyrical storytelling. For example, the snake, which became prominent during the "Reputation" era, represents her rise from public scrutiny and personal struggles. The heart symbolizes love, loss, and the complexity of relationships, often taking center stage in her ballads.

What Are Some Iconic Symbols from Taylor Swift's Music Videos?

Many of Taylor Swift's music videos feature iconic symbols that enhance her storytelling. Here are a few notable examples:

  • "Look What You Made Me Do": The snake motif is prominently displayed, symbolizing transformation and empowerment.
  • "All Too Well (10 Minute Version)": The use of autumn leaves represents nostalgia and the passage of time.
  • "Blank Space": The car symbolizes the thrill and danger of romance.
